Data Ownership and Privacy: Investigating a Shared Psychological Basis

2025· other· W7154619329 on OpenAlexaff
Cognitive Science Society 2025, Breanna Amoyaw, Shaylene E Nancekivell, Katie Szilagyi

Abstract

People often share their personal data online despite reporting that they should not. They also show surprise and distress when data is used in ways they authorize despite giving consent. But, what underlies this inconsistency in people’s thinking? In the present study, we investigated the proposal that thinking about control over information, or informational autonomy, likely underlies variability in thinking about privacy and data ownership. Namely, we propose that threats to one’s autonomy might account for the aforementioned changes in people’s concern for their data. To test this account, we used a survey-style design to measure how a hypothetical threat to the self, and thereby control, influenced adults’ (N = 51) judgments about the ownership and privacy of their personal data. The threat was police lawfully obtaining their data with a warrant. We found that privacy and ownership judgments significantly increased over time. We also found that the variability in participants’ ownership and privacy judgments was related. Together, our findings suggest that privacy and ownership likely have a shared psychological basis, and this shared psychology can likely explain the variability in people’s judgments about personal data across time.
